Ticket: Post-postmortem config drift — Hearthcache

Following the stale-cache incident writeup (INC review last Thursday), we audited the Hearthcache fleet and found three nodes still running pre-incident settings: the old TTL, the disabled invalidation hook, and the longer refresh interval. This is exactly the drift that let stale pricing pages persist for six hours. Remediation is to re-apply the agreed baseline via the deploy pipeline and lock manual edits. For the sync, the corrected baseline configuration is listed below.

deployment values, yadug-bawif:
[framir]
team = pelox
access_code = ac_a38ab2
owner = tamion.julael
host = framir.tolvaqlabs.test
port = 11211
peer = tammir.zemvargrid.local
salt = 2215ef03
pin = 1541

## Authentication

Heads up: the nightly reindex job (`reindex_nightly.py`) talks to the Lanternfish search cluster, and that cluster won't accept anonymous writes anymore — we locked it down last sprint. The job now authenticates as the `reindex-runner` service identity against Corvid Gateway, and the token is injected via the `LF_INDEX_TOKEN` env var in the scheduler config. Nothing clever going on, just a bearer header on every batch request. For review purposes, the staging credential currently in use is listed below.

service key, kadug-kadup: kto15_rN23XLAYImmZgrJ

## Formula sandbox tuning

User-supplied formulas in Gridmoor execute inside a restricted interpreter with hard ceilings on time, memory, and call depth. Reviewers should confirm any change to these ceilings is justified in the PR description, since raising them widens the abuse surface. Defaults were chosen from production traces. The current limits are as follows.

limits module of tafog-fawip:
WEIGHTS = {
    "julix": 57,
    "lamys": 992,
    "kasvan": 209,
    "quenok": 750,
    "alddor": 259,
    "oliath": 1009,
    "wenix": 815,
}